BUSTED - Illicit trade in antiquities gang headed by major hotel owner!

The owner of a major hotel chain in the Attica region is according to some press reports suspected by authorities of being in charge of a gang involved in the illicit trades in antiquities and sacred icons.

At the request of a judicial officer in Ioannina, who had discovered the hotelier’s suspect activities an investigation was immediately launched by authorities in Athens and three major cities in the Peloponnese, in Thessaly as well as in Epirus.

Reports in the Greek press, quoting police officials, claim that during the investigation in Thessaly, one alleged member of the gang, who worked as a shepherd, was found with three pistols, about 80,000 euros in cash and at least three luxury cars.

(Apparently business was good!)

The same reports also talk about a police raid that took place in a bookbindery shop in down town Athens, promising to reveal all on Friday afternoon.

Simitis says he regrets travesties (scandals) during the time he was PM

Former Prime Minister Costas Simitis, as well as the present leader of the controversial PASOK party, Evangelos Venizelos, on Wednesday began testifying in the appeals case, in relation to the bribes in scandalous armament deals, which was launched by former Minister of National Defense Akis Tsohatzopoulos.

When questioned, Simitis said that he was not aware of anything about the illegal actions of the defendants and what is attributed to them.
     "What I know comes from the newspapers and the courts” e said while he revealed that the KYSEA does not have any investigative powers, nor does it negotiate and discuss offset benefits.
He said that weapons cannot be purchased unless a proposal is made by the Ministry of National Defense.

When asked whether bribery was possible in the KYSEA’s proceedings, the former Greek PM said that "if it happened, it is possible” and explained that the prices of military supplies and armaments are not known and are determined case-by-case.

He also said that he regretted the "these travesties" took place under his premiership when his efforts were to upgrade and modernize the country.

Certainly the most controversial part of his testimony was when he referred to the issue of Imia and said that the reason the helicopter crashed -killing three Greek soldiers- was because it was in the air for too long. Simitis explained how the crisis with Turkey at the time over the Imia Islets highlighted the need to update the Hellenic Armed forces, in order to counter a possible escalation.

It should be reminded that both Simitis and Venizelos were summoned by the courts at the request of Tsochatzopoulos since they were part of the Government Council for National Defense (KYSEA) during the critical period when the defective submarines and TOR M1 purchases were made (the KYSEA is the body with the highest authority on such matters). Other veteran PASOK ministers who were part of the KYSEA at the time include Vaso Papandreou and Yannos Papantoniou, -who are also set to testify on May20th.-

A week later, in the 27th of May, three high-ranking military officers that were also part of the KYSEA – Athanasios Tzoganis, Manolis Paragioudakis and Giorgos Ioannidis – are due to take the stand.

According to the former National Defense Minister, the controversial arms deals involves strategic government choices that were made by this controversial KYSEA and as such it was not possible to make illegal payments for legal and approved supply contacts. The courts argue that the trial aims to investigate the alleged bribery charge and not the legal status of the supply contracts. After all, KYSEA members have previously stated that the council decides on contracts based on the recommendations from the military and political leadership of the Ministry of National Defense.

BUSTED - Authorities arrest L. Bobolas for tax evasion

Businessman (and one of Greece's most influential oligarchs) Leonidas Bobolas was arrested on Wednesday for tax evasion. The businessman, 53, who heads the ELLAKTOR company, was arrested by financial police after a Public Order was issued against him for tax evasion. (His family has a large share of MEGA tv, as well as other publications). Bobolas was then immediately led before a Greek prosecutor.

According to SKAI tv and reporter Ioanna Mandrou, the order was issued on Tuesday afternoon and concerns (possible undeclared) funds (13 million euros) that she claims were discovered on the Lagarde List as well as in other foreign accounts.

Leonidas Bobolas paid a 1.8 million euro bail after he was arrested on tax evasion and money laundering charges, in relation to the Lagarde list investigations. Reports said that the charges against him concern a sum of 4 million euros. He was contacted to pay 2 million euros, but never did.

That is why he was arrested and then taken before a Greek prosecutor, where he faced the examiner and responded to the charges.

His brother Fotis Bobolas (huge stake owner of Teletypos and MEGA channel) has also reportedly paid a 1.8-million-euro fine.

A news report at 13:00 on Skai Tv also said that Bobolas decided to pay his more than 1.8 million debt in taxes and hinted that charges would soon be dropped against him.

Leonidas Bobolas' father, George, has developed properties all over the Balkan region and the M.East for over the past 40 years. The family, which owns stakes in the TV channel MEGA, also has stakes in many publications. One of his sons, Fotis, is the director of Teletypos, or MEGA channel's holding company. His other son, Leonidas, is the chief executive and a major shareholder of ELLAKTOR, a construction giant founded by his father that has participated in multi-billion euro contracts with the state. The family as a whole also controls the Ethnos newspaper, other print media and/or  websites. BUSTED - Greek archaeologist discovers Christie’s artefacts linked to organised crime

Eight rare antiquities were apparently pulled from auction by Christie’s over the past six months after a Greek research assistant at the university’s Scottish Centre for Crime and Justice Research uncovered images of them in archives seized from Italian art dealers convicted of trafficking offences, an article on www.scotsman.com said.

According to the report, the latest tranche of treasures were due to be sold at auction in London on Tuesdsay, but after Dr Christos Tsirogiannis notified Interpol and Italian authorities, they were removed.

Tsirogiannis discovered the four lots catalogued in the confiscated archives of Giancomo Medici and Gianfranco Becchina, and warned Christie’s was failing to carry out “due diligence”.

Medici was sentenced to ten years in prison in 2004 by a Rome court after he was found guilty of conspiracy to traffic in antiquities. Becchina, a Sicilian antiquities dealer, was convicted in Rome four years ago of trafficking in plundered artefacts.

Dr Tsirogiannis, a forensic archaeologist, has access to their photos and documents via Greek police and prosecutors.

The items accepted for Tuesday’s antiquities sale date back to 540BC. They include an Attic black-figured amphora and an Etruscan terracotta antefix. Cumulatively, they are worth close to £100,000.

It is the second time in six months Dr Tsirogiannis has highlighted the dubiety of items being sold through Christie’s. The value of the eight withdrawn lots exceeds £1.2 million.

Dr Tsirogiannis, is a member of Trafficking Culture, a Glasgow-based research programme which compiles evidence of the contemporary global trade in looted cultural objects.

A spokeswoman for Christie’s said:
     “We have withdrawn four lots from our upcoming antiquities sale as it was brought to our attention that there is a question mark over their provenance, namely, that they are similar to items recorded in the Medici and Becchina archives.

BUSTED - Hardouvelis: I sent money abroad because I was scared (VIDEO)

Former finance minister Gikas Hardouvelis admitted that he transferred some of his savings to foreign bank accounts in 2012, because he was “scared like all Greeks”. While speaking to STAR Tv earlier this week, the former minister was forced to explain his actions following the revelation in last Sunday’s Real News newspaper that he is being investigated for alleged failure to comply with his tax obligations.

Hardouvelis noted that he has paid all taxes and that any foreign bank accounts he has were opened only because he had also worked abroad. Funds were only sent to those accounts when he was not a minister.
     "I'm taxed for the sums of money the newspaper is referring to. The money is the result of many years of work -- mine and my wife's. My tax reports confirm that", said Hardouvelis.
The controversial money transfers occurred in May 2012, when he was responsible for the financial office of former Prime Minister Lucas Papademos.

Hardouvelis admitted that, despite the fact that during the period in question he advised the Greeks not to transfer money abroad, he did the opposite, for.... family reasons.
     "Like many Greeks, I transferred some of my money abroad for an emergency, because my child was abroad”.
Explaining the fact that the transfers were carried out in relatively small tranches, he said that this was because the transfers were completed by himself through e-banking.
     "I have nothing to hide. In my life, everything I've done transparently, my life is a mirror, " Hardouvelis added.

Police arrest Xiros' accomplice Angeliki Spyropoulou

Police officials on Monday arrested Angeliki Spyropoulou, the 22-year-old female accomplice of notorious Nov.17 convicted terrorist Christodoulos Xiros. She is suspected of being a member of the Conspiracy of Fire Cells (SPF) terrorist group. Authorities had launched a manhunt to arrest Spyropoulou, since the capture of Xiros early in January.

According to MEGA tv, the 22-year-old was arrested in the area of Salamina (an island off of Piraeus in southern Athens). More precisely, she was found her at the home of Christos and Gerasimos Tsakalos (brothers), who are both serving a sentence for belonging to the same terrorist organisation.

Spyropoulou, was allegedly aiding Xiros when he was a fugitive, as well as in a plan to spring imprisoned members of the extreme-leftist terror gang Conspiracy of Fire Cells from Korydallos prison.

The mother of both the Tsakalos brothers, who at the time of the arrest was giving testimony at the office of the investigative magistrate on a different aspect of the Xiros case, was immediately arrested by authorities for harboring a criminal.

The arrest comes after three other suspects were detained at the weekend, all of whom also face similar terrorism-related charges.

One of the three detainees includes a 32-year-old man who is accused of passing on a number of items to Spyropoulou, which were to be used in the Korydallos prison break plan. The list of items includes digital files, about 6,000 euros in cash, a GPS jammer and even laser scopes which were to be used in the assault on the prison.

The other suspect, according to one report in the To Vima newspaper, says that another detainee, a 36-year-old woman, is suspected of acting as a liaison between Xiros, Angeliki Spyropoulou as well as a third suspect. The same report also points out that DNA traces of the third detainee, a 39-year-old man, were discovered in a mail bomb that had been sent to prosecutor Dimitris Mokkas in September 2013, as well as a time bomb that was sent to the Korydallos tax office in March 2014 and an explosive bomb that was delivered to the Itea Police Department director in April 2014.

On the subject of Greek terrorists, three Greek convicted terrorists who are currently being held in the Domokos high security prison (central Greece) on Monday announced that they were beginning a hunger strike to protest against anti-terror laws, and in favour of the abolition of high security prisons.

Dimitris Koufontinas, 57, serving multiple life sentences for crimes related to his membership of the November 17 terrorist organisation, and Kostas Gournas, convicted for his membership in the terrorist organisation Revolutionary Struggle, co-signed a statement saying they protest, among others, against anti-terror laws.

The same was announced in a separate statement, signed by Nikos Maziotis, convicted for membership in the Revolutionary Struggle terrorist group.

BUSTED - Lawyer In Vatopedi Case Finally Convicted of Extortion

An Appeals Court convicted a Greek lawyer to 36 months in prison with a three-year suspension for extortion related to property transferred to the Vatopedi Monastery. The case is related to property claims of farmers renting land in Nea Redestos, which had been transferred to the Vatopedi Monastery on Mont Athos and was then sold to the company "Anthemias".

The case came to light when a video emerged showing the lawyer, Mihalis Koukouvinos, asking for money from a businessman to block the legal actions of the farmers.

Apart from extortion, Koukouvinos was also found guilty of fraud at misdemeanor level for a transaction involving one of his clients.

Papakonstantinou Finally Faces Special Court - Time For Justice

Former Minister of Finance George Papakonstantinou (under the George Papandreou government) finally took the stand in the Special Court on Wednesday, where he is now expected to address the charges that have been brought against him in relation to the controversial Lagarde list. In his opening statement the former minister denied the charges and said that he is innocent.

Papakonstantinou is charged with tampering with an official State document as well as an attempted breach of faith. It should be reminded that Papakonstantinou was charged with tampering with the Lagarde list, which contains the names of more than 2,000 Greeks -and suspected tax evaders- with cash deposits at a Geneva branch of HSBC in an effort to remove the names of three of his relatives.

Reports claim that the Court might focus on the criminal liabilities of Papakonstantinou, rather than the general social, financial or political landscape.

Papakonstantinou was referred to the Special Court by the Supreme Court’s Judicial Council.

The 'Lagarde list' is an electronic file that was sent to the Greek finance ministry by French authorities several years ago, containing the names of wealthy Greeks with sizable deposits in the Geneva-based branch of HSBC. It was received when Papakonstantinou was finance minister, under the (very controversial) George Papandreou government.

Heavy sentences for members of Conspiracy of Fire terrorist group

An Athens criminal court on Monday sentenced 15 young people accused of being members of terrorist group Conspiracy of Fire with sentences that range anywhere from five to 25 years. Some of the members had already been convicted of other crimes, a report on the online To Vima news service said.

Three of the accused received 25 years in jail; another three members were sentenced to 24 years and 2 months; one member was sentenced to 21 years and 9 months; one other to 20 years; another member to 19 years; another member to 16 years in absentia; two other members were sentenced to 14 years; one to 6 years; and finally one member was sentenced to only five years.

One member, a woman, was acquitted of being part of the organization, but was sentenced to six years as an accessory to several counts of weapons possession and a 16th defendant, male, was also acquitted of membership in the terrorist organization but received 6 months (suspended for three years), for the misdemeanor of a weapon possession.

Trial of Papakonstantinou to begin Feb.25th

The trial of former finance minister George Papakonstantinou is scheduled to begin on February 25th. The date of the trial was announced by Nicholas Passos, the head of the Special Court that is assigned to try the former minister.

Among other things, Papakonstantinou is charged of striking the names of his relatives and their husbands from a list of Swiss bank accounts from the HSBC branch in Geneva. France's then-finance minister Christine Lagarde, now head of the International Monetary Fund (IMF), forwarded a part of the list to the Greek government, hence the widely-used name of "Lagarde List".

Supreme Court’s Judicial Council Refers Papakonstantinou to Special Court

Former Minister of Finance George Papakonstantinou was referred to the Special Court on Thursday by the Supreme Court’s Judicial Council, on charges of distorting documents and attempted infidelity.

The Judicial Council cleared Papakonstantinou of the breach of conduct charges and at the same time also cleared three of his family members of instigation charges, in relation to accounts contained in the controversial Lagarde List which the former Minister is accused of tampering.

The 'Lagarde list' is an electronic file that was sent to the Greek finance ministry by French authorities several years ago, containing the names of Greeks with sizable deposits in the Geneva-based branch of HSBC. It was received when Papakonstantinou was finance minister, under the (very controversial) George Papandreou government.

When the list was sent to Greece, it suddenly disappeared and only resurfaced after several months, without any action to follow up the information it contained.

The USB stick was eventually given to Prime Minister Antonis Samaras by none other than Evangelos Venizelos -who apparently succeeded Papakonstantinou as finance minister-.

The deception was actually revealed after French authorities provided a second copy of the list to Greek authorities and Venizelos was forced to materialize the USB stick. Further investigation showed that the copies in the hands of Greek authorities had been tampered with and some names removed, including depositors that were first cousins with Papakonstantinou.

As such, the public prosecutor that was assigned to the case proposed that Papakonstantinou be indicted on charges of breach of faith, violation of duty and doctoring a document. At the same time he also proposed that his cousin Helen Papakonstantinou, her husband Simeon Sikiaridis and Andreas Rossonis also face the same fate.

The proposal was made several months ago to the Judicial Council, which then convened so as to deliver the relevant Ordinance.

The ordinance that was issued today is irrevocable (ie not subject to any appeal) and is scheduled to be indulged within a ten day period of its release to Papakostadinou as well as to the President of the Greek Parliament.

Now that the ordinance refers Papakonstadinou to trial, the Head of the Greek Parliament has to hold a draw, which will choose the members of the Supreme Court and the State Council that are to rule the case. Basically he has to draw 13 names, and six more alternate names so that the formation of the Special Court (council of judges) is achieved.

The members of the Supreme Court are expected to number seven and six more of the CoE, while the highest ranking member of the Supreme Court is going to exercise presidential duties.

As such, the President of the Special Court, after receiving the list with the names that were drawn in Parliament, must  set a court date within 60 days, along with the place of the official court meeting and the list of witnesses.

Papakonstantinou, who has the right to be represented with up to three lawyers, also has the right not to appear in court. Nonetheless the case will still stand trial whether or not he is there, as was the case with Andreas Papandreou in the Koskotas scandal trial in April of 1991.

It should be noted that Papakonstantinou is not protected by the statue of limitations, which dictates that offenses allegedly committed by ex-ministers expire if two parliaments have sat since the offense.

Let us not forget that the case also accused the former head of the Financial Crime squad Yiannis Diotis and Yiannis Kapeleris of foul play.

Diotis, who was given a copy of the Lagarde list on a memory stick by Papakonstantinou, is alleged to have modified it and faces charges of stealing an official document, while Diotis’s predecessor Kapeleris, who Papakonstantinou gave a sample of 20 names from the list to investigate, faces charges of breach of faith.

Papakonstantinou has kept low after being released on bail, but is still required to appear before police authorities every 15 days. He has denied all charges and claims that he is being made a scapegoat for the inaction of others (meaning Venizelos) and his later departure from government.

BUSTED - IKA governor Could Be Facing Fraud Charges

Social Insurance Fund (IKA) governor Rovertos Spyropoulos (a high ranking official from PASOK) could be possibly facing charges for breaching of faith and aggravated fraud against the state, according to a proposal tabled to a Judicial Council by the prosecutor investigating the case of a supermarket chain with million-euro debts to the social insurance organisation.

The case file, according to a report from ANA-MPA, concerns a decision by Spyropoulos to lift the confiscation order of bank accounts that belonged to "Arvanitidis" supermarket chain even though the company owed to IKA 18 million euros in contributions.

The report notes that the prosecutor believes that the two company owners should be charged with moral complicity.

The decision made by Spyropoulos to lift the confiscation of the bank accounts in question, adds the same report, caused damages to the social insurance organization, considering that within a few days after the decision, large amounts, that could have been impounded to repay the debt, disappeared from the company's bank accounts, the prosecutor underlined.

On his part, Spyropoulos has denied all charges, and maintains that all his actions were legal (but then again we have heard this before from many PASOK officials). He has also said that he asked that the confiscation order be lifted to give time to the company to settle its outstanding debts and backpay to its employees, enter a settlement with IKA and avoid bankruptcy.

BUSTED - 2 men convicted of illicit antiquities trade

Two men received heavy prison sentences on Tuesday after being convicted by a court in the northern city of Thessaloniki for smuggling of antiquities in a case that was first revealed on October 2011. According to a report by the sate news agency ANA-MPA, one of the defendants was sentenced to 20 years of prison, while the second received 8 years and was released conditionally, pending his appeal.

The report claims that the men were arrested by police in 2011 as they were preparing to sell several ancient artifacts valued at 11.5 million euros. The priceless goods were part of a large Macedonian treasure which they had hidden in the area of Gerakarou, near the city of Thessaloniki.

Authorities took on the case after the Greek Ministry of Culture received an anonymous letter revealing the men’s connection to illicit antiquities trade.

It is reported that among the treasures recovered by police were four helmets, golden masks and mouthpieces, a glass vase, clay and metallic vessels, clay figurines, rosettes and other golden objects, including a section of a golden diadem with embossed decoration, and fragments of an iron sword with decoration.

One of the antiquities smugglers also showed police the two archaic tombs from which they stole most of the objects.

The artifacts were so important that after they were confiscated, they were transferred to the National Archaeological Museum of Athens where they were officially presented.
